The following factors could affect Italian markets on Thursday.Reuters has not verified the newspaper reports, and cannot vouch for their accuracy. New items are marked with (*).For a complete list of diary events in Italy please click on .ECONOMYISTAT releases June unemployment rate data (0800 GMT); July CPI flash data (0900 GMT); June producer prices data (1000 GMT).COMPANIESUNICREDIT MIL:UCG, BANCO BPM MIL:BAMIEconomy Minister Giancarlo Giorgetti said on Wednesday that UniCredit's investments in Russian sovereign bonds through its local unit expose the group to the risk of possible international sanctions.He added that Rome had acted to defend the national interest by imposing tough conditions on the lender's failed bid for Banco BPM through its so-called "golden powers" aimed at shielding key assets.MEDIOBANCA(*) The investment bank on Thursday reported record annual results and said it is considering bringing forward by a month a shareholder vote on its bid for private bank Banca Generali MIL:BGN. The bank, which last month unveiled a plan to return 4.9 billion euros ($5.61 billion) to shareholders over the next three years, said it is ready to launch a new 400-million-euro tranche of its share buyback programme.Conference call at 0800 GMT. (*) MEDIOBANCA, UNICREDIT, GENERALI MIL:G, BANCA MPS MIL:BMPSA shareholders' meeting of Delfin, the holding company of the family of late entrepreneur Leonardo Del Vecchio, will vote on Thursday on a proposal to divest all non-core assets, while holding on to the stake in EssilorLuxottica EURONEXT:EL, Il Sole 24 Ore reported on Thursday.NEXI (NEXI.MI)(*) The payments group said on Thursday it posted a 3.7% rise in its second-quarter core profit, slightly above a company-provided consensus, and confirmed its guidance for 2025. Nexi's core profit (EBITDA) for the period totalled 482.3 million euros ($551.51 million), ahead of the consensus of 480 million euros.Conference call at 0600 GMT.FINECOBANK (FNK.MI)(*) The fintech bank posted on Thursday a second-quarter net profit of 153.6 million euros ($175.7 million), down 11.3% from 164.2 million euros a year earlier.
